Drain Cleaning delivers a core plumbing service intended to remove buildup and blockages in residential and commercial drainage systems. Using specialized equipment such as motorized augers, hydro-jetters, and drain cameras, technicians restore optimal flow and reduce recurring blockages. This service is essential for maintaining hygienic and efficient wastewater removal while reducing the risk of plumbing emergencies
